    Robert Lewis Thomson (born August 16, 1963), nicknamed "Topper", is a Canadian professional baseball manager for the Philadelphia Phillies of Major League Baseball. During Thomson’s playing career, he was a catcher and third baseman in the Detroit Tigers organization from 1985 to 1988.

  4. Feb 5, 2019 · Years: 1988 to current. Teams: Detroit, NY Yankees, Philadelphia. Rob Thomson. Born in 1963 in Sarnia, Ont., Rob Thomson grew up in nearby Corunna. A standout player for the Intercounty League’s Stratford Hillers in the early ’80s, Thomson was recruited by Dick Groch, later a famous New York Yankees scout, to play for St. Clair Community College.
